It's tough to win Best-of-Show at a major coffee festival with a product that's not coffee but FIgBrew did just that for two years in a row.  Made from organic figs, it's a single ingredient coffee supplement that can be brewed any way that coffee can be brewed - including espresso, drip, or cold-brew.  Figgee really shines when brewed using these more robust brewing methods giving a strong bold flavor without the bitterness.  Micro-manage your caffeine addiction to zero with Figgee.  Click here for video on how to make Figgee espresso.

Instants and herbals just don't cut it for true coffee drinkers. It’s about twice as strong as coffee so use half as much.  A single ingredient with no sugar added - only 12-calories and 2.4g of carbs (fructose) per serving.
